Property Location
With a stay at Super 8 by Wyndham Bloomington in Bloomington, you'll be near the airport, within a 5-minute drive of Illinois State University and The Shoppes at College Hills. This motel is 1.4 mi (2.2 km) from OSF HealthCare and 1.5 mi (2.4 km) from Eastland Mall.

Rooms
Make yourself at home in one of the 60 guestrooms featuring refrigerators and microwaves. Flat-screen televisions with cable programming provide entertainment, while complimentary wireless internet access keeps you connected. Private bathrooms with shower/tub combinations feature complimentary toiletries and hair dryers. Conveniences include desks and coffee/tea makers, and housekeeping is provided daily.

Business, Other Amenities
Featured amenities include a 24-hour front desk and laundry facilities. Free self parking is available onsite.
